The Cooperative Agreement Form for the University of Cumberlands in Middlesex enables parties to formalize subleasing arrangements within cooperative apartment settings. It establishes essential elements such as the identification of the sublessor and sublessee, the dwelling unit's details, and the rental terms, ensuring mutual understanding of obligations. Key features include provisions for rental payment schedules, maintenance responsibilities, and the sublessee's compliance with cooperative bylaws. Users are guided through filling the form by inserting relevant personal and property details, and it emphasizes the importance of obtaining approval from the cooperative board. Specific use cases for this form include rental agreements between individuals within cooperative communities, onboarding of tenants, and legal documentation for housing attorneys assisting clients. This form is vital for operators and users in legal fields, including attorneys, partners, owners, associates, paralegals, and legal assistants, as it helps in managing tenant relationships and securing rights within cooperative housing agreements.

Frequently Asked Questions. When can I apply and when can I begin CPT? You are eligible to apply up to 90 days before the end of your first year of study. The actual CPT employment can begin only after the first academic year is complete.

Day 1 CPT Course Structure Each semester comprises three courses. A mandatory three-day in-person class is held each semester, typically from Friday to Sunday. Non-attendance can jeopardize a student's F1 status. The University doesn't mandate an on-campus workplace, allowing students to pursue CPT anywhere.
